Abstract
The invention relates to the field of electronic element material preparation, in particular to an automatic magnetic powder punching device. The automatic magnetic powder punching device comprises a transmission belt, a fixing frame, a power air cylinder and a punching disc; the fixing frame which is a door-shaped frame is arranged on the conveying belt; the power air cylinder is fixed on a cross beam of the fixing frame; the punching disc is fixedly connected with an extensible rod of the power air cylinder; the punching disc comprises a disc surface and a punching rod; the disc surface is provided with a plurality of isometric array installation holes; the punching rod penetrate the installation holes and can relatively slide; the punching rod and the disc surface are fixedly connected through a spring; the end portion of the punching rod is provided with a cross punching head; a vertical pile of the fixing frame is provided with an optical fiber sensor which is used for detecting a mineral powder box. The automatic magnetic powder punching device has the advantages of achieving automatic loosening of mineral powder, saving manual costs, being uniform in punching and not easy to collapse, enabling the mineral powder to be fully oxidized during roasting and achieving the product percent of pass.
Description
Technical field
The invention belongs to materials of electronic components preparation field, particularly magnetic automatic punching device.
Background technology
Along with the develop rapidly of electron trade, people are more and more higher for the performance requirement of magnetic core, magnetic is the important source material of compacting magnetic core, magnetic powder materials generally adopts hematite, main containing di-iron trioxide, carry out being oxidized the magnetic powder materials being formed and also have tri-iron tetroxide to hematite in combustion furnace, carry out Powdered in order to roasting evenly generally needs that hematite is carried out powder crushing process, it so just can be made fully oxidized, the not easy-to-use larger container splendid attire of pulverous breeze, even if smaller container splendid attire also needs to loosen to breeze, now loose mode stamps loose hole to box-packed breeze, general drill process needs manually to complete, and it is uneven to punch, cause partial oxidation bad, product percent of pass is declined.
Summary of the invention
The object of this invention is to provide a kind of even and that efficiency is higher magnetic automatic punching device that punches.
To achieve these goals, magnetic automatic punching device provided by the invention, comprise conveyer belt, fixed mount, actuating cylinder and punching dish, described fixed mount is door type frame and arranges on a moving belt, described actuating cylinder is fixed on the crossbeam of fixed mount, described punching dish is fixedly connected with the expansion link of actuating cylinder, described punching dish comprises card and punching bar, card is provided with the installing hole of multiple equidistant array, described punching bar passes installing hole and energy relative sliding, be fixedly connected with by spring between punching bar and card, punching boom end is provided with cross perforating head, the soldier piles of described fixed mount are provided with the Fibre Optical Sensor detecting breeze box.
The magnetic automatic punching device of this programme when in use, the breeze box that breeze is housed, at conveyer belt, when breeze box passes through below perforating device time, is detected by Fibre Optical Sensor, now connect the circuit of actuating cylinder, make actuating cylinder action, the expansion link of actuating cylinder takes punching dish to and declines, and the punching bar of punching dish is declined rapidly, breeze is punched, make to form cellular in breeze box, after actuating cylinder is retracted, conveyer belt continues to drive breeze box to move.
The invention has the advantages that: by automatic punching device, achieve and automatically breeze is loosened, eliminate cost of labor, and punching evenly, not easily caves in, make breeze when roasting, can obtain fully oxidized, reach the qualification rate of product.
As preferred scheme, the expansion link of described actuating cylinder is provided with the blocking material frame for blocking breeze box, blocking material frame is connected on expansion link by back-moving spring, after breeze box is detected by Fibre Optical Sensor, the expansion link of actuating cylinder is shot out, when stretching out, first be that breeze box position is fixed by blocking material frame, no longer decline after end in contact stationary support under blocking material frame, then the bar that punches just punches, prior like this breeze box position of giving is fixed, and can not produce vibration when punching to breeze box.
As preferred scheme, described Fibre Optical Sensor is provided with symmetrical two, reduces measure error by the detection of two sensors, thus avoids actuating cylinder to produce misoperation.
As preferred scheme, described perforating head end is set to plane, and plane adhesion has buffer rubber gasket; Can prevent from punching pole pair breeze box from producing by buffer rubber gasket to destroy.
